Dichloroacetic acid improves in vitro myocardial function following in vivo endotoxin administration
Reads0
Chats0
TLDR
The data show that DCA aguments myocardial performance in hearts from endotoxin-injected rats, and it restores the depressed ATP concentration to normal levels.About:
